About This Tour

The Rajputana Desert Circuit is a popular travel route that covers the major desert cities and historic regions of Rajasthan. It focuses on forts, palaces, desert landscapes, and traditional culture shaped by Rajput history.

This circuit usually includes cities like Jodhpur, Jaisalmer. Each city offers a different view of desert life, from blue houses and hill forts to golden sandstone architecture and wide sand dunes.

In Jaisalmer, visitors explore desert forts and experience camel safaris at Sam Sand Dunes. Jodhpur is known for Mehrangarh Fort and its old blue city area. offers places like and a strong connection to camel culture.

The circuit also highlights desert traditions such as folk music, dance, local crafts, and traditional food. Markets, villages, and festivals give a closer look at daily life in the Thar Desert region.

This route is ideal for travelers who want to experience Rajasthan’s desert heritage, historic architecture, and cultural lifestyle in a single journey.

Itinerary

Day 1: Arrival in Jodhpur and visit Mehrangarh Fort and Umaid Bhawan

Arrive in Jodhpur and move through the dry air of the city toward your hotel. The land here feels open, with stone and dust shaping the edges of the streets. After some rest, walk up to Mehrangarh Fort. The fort rises from rock and holds its ground above the city.

From the walls, you see blue houses spread across the plain. The color holds heat and light through the day. Inside, rooms show old tools, weapons, and objects shaped for daily use and war. Each space reflects a slow passage of time.

Later, visit Umaid Bhawan Palace. The building stands wide and balanced, with clean lines and pale stone. Part of it still holds the royal family, while another part opens to visitors.

In the evening, walk near the Clock Tower. The market moves with sound, voices, and the smell of spices. Stay overnight in Jodhpur.

Day 1: Explore Jodhpur city and local markets

Start your day with a short walk to Jaswant Thada. The white marble reflects morning light and stands quiet beside the fort.

Move into the old city and follow the narrow lanes. The blue walls hold shade and keep the air cooler. Small shops line the paths and sell cloth, spices, and simple goods. People move at a steady pace through the streets.

You can stop often and watch daily life unfold. The city does not rush, and time feels slower here. Keep the day open and move as you wish. Stay overnight in Jodhpur.

Day 3 : Drive to Jaisalmer and visit Jaisalmer Fort

After breakfast, leave Jodhpur and drive toward Jaisalmer. The road cuts through dry land with low shrubs and scattered trees. You pass small villages where life depends on limited water and careful use of land.

The journey takes about 5 to 6 hours. The sky stays wide, and the horizon remains clear through most of the drive.

After arrival, visit Jaisalmer Fort. The fort rises from the desert and holds homes, shops, and temples within its walls. People still live and work inside, and the space feels active.

Walk through the narrow paths and watch how daily life fits within the fort. You can also visit Patwon Ki Haveli or spend time near the fort area. Stay overnight in Jaisalmer.

Day 4 : Desert safari and overnight camping at Sam or Khuri dunes

Travel toward the open desert near Sam Sand Dunes or Khuri village. The land shifts here, and sand forms long ridges shaped by steady wind.

Take a camel and move slowly across the dunes. The animal follows known paths, and each step settles into the sand. As the sun lowers, the light softens and spreads across the surface.

Why does the sand change shape each day Wind moves across the open land and shifts grains from one place to another. The dunes never stay still.

After sunset, reach your desert camp. Sit through a simple evening with local music and food. The night grows quiet, and the temperature drops. The sky opens wide, and stars remain clear above the desert. Stay overnight in desert camp.

Day 5 : Visit Pokhran Museum and return to Jodhpur for departure

After breakfast, begin the return drive toward Jodhpur. Stop at Pokhran Museum along the way. The museum holds local objects, tools, and records from the region.

These items show how people have lived with dry land and scarce water over time. Each object reflects careful use and long survival.

Continue your journey back to Jodhpur. The road retraces the same dry stretches and open views. After reaching the city, prepare for your onward travel.

  • The tour covers major desert cities like Jodhpur, Jaisalmer with a mix of heritage and desert experiences.
  • Travel involves long road journeys between cities, so comfortable transport and planned breaks are important.
  • Desert areas can have extreme temperatures. Days may be hot and nights cooler, especially near Sam Sand Dunes.
  • Light cotton clothes are suitable for daytime, while warmer layers are useful during evenings and winter months.
  • Carry sunscreen, sunglasses, and sufficient water during sightseeing in open desert regions.
  • Mobile network may be limited in remote desert areas and during safari experiences.
  • Respect local customs, traditions, and dress modestly while visiting villages and religious places.
  • Advance booking is recommended during peak season, especially for desert camps and popular attractions.
  • Keep valid ID proof and travel documents handy throughout the journey.
